Opel Astra:

The Opel Astra is a compact car/small family car developed and produced by the German automaker Opel since 1991, currently at its sixth generation. It was first launched in September 1991 as a direct replacement to the Opel Kadett. As of 2025, the car slots between the smaller Corsa supermini and the larger Frontera subcompact crossover SUV.
Initially, the Astra was available in hatchback, saloon, and estate forms. A panel van and a convertible also appeared in the early 1990s. These body styles were later followed by a coupé in 2004, and the sporty Astra OPC appeared in 2005. The Twin Top retractable hardtop convertible replaced the soft top convertible in 2006, while the Caravan was renamed to Astra Sports Tourer since 2009....(Read more on Wikipedia)

G Caravan Overview:

Opel Astra (G Caravan). With 125 Nm of torque, it offers ample pulling power. It has moderate fuel consumption (~11.1 l/100km). Weighing only 1110 kg, it’s quite light. Front‑wheel drive delivers efficiency and easy handling. Acceleration is relatively slow (0–100 km/h in 15.5 s). The top speed reaches 163 km/h. A car with an extended rear cargo area, combining passenger comfort with increased storage. Seating for 5 makes it ideal for daily use.

1.4 Ecotec 16V (90 Hp) Automatic Verdict:

Rating 3 stars

Performance Verdict

Struggles with the weight of the Caravan, especially with the automatic transmission, leading to slow acceleration.

Fuel Economy

Poor fuel economy for a 1.4L engine, as the automatic gearbox works harder to compensate for the lack of power.

Best Use Case: Strictly city driving, very light loads.
